package com.threerings.jme.model;
import java.io.IOException;
import java.util.Properties;
import com.jme.math.Vector3f;
import com.jme.scene.Controller;
import com.jme.scene.Spatial;
import com.jme.util.export.JMEExporter;
import com.jme.util.export.JMEImporter;
import com.jme.util.export.InputCapsule;
import com.jme.util.export.OutputCapsule;
import com.threerings.jme.util.JmeUtil;
/**
* A procedural animation that moves a node along a straight line at a constant velocity (then
* either repeats or moves it in the other direction).
*/
public class Translator extends ModelController
{
@Override
public void configure (Properties props, Spatial target)
{
super.configure(props, target);
_from = JmeUtil.parseVector3f(props.getProperty("from", "0, 0, 0"));
_to = JmeUtil.parseVector3f(props.getProperty("to", "10, 0, 0"));
_duration = Float.parseFloat(props.getProperty("duration", "1"));
_repeatType = JmeUtil.parseRepeatType(props.getProperty("repeat_type"),
Controller.RT_WRAP);
}
// documentation inherited
public void update (float time)
{
if (!isActive()) {
return;
}
_elapsed += (time / _duration);
float alpha;
if (_repeatType == Controller.RT_CLAMP) {
alpha = Math.min(_elapsed, 1f);
} else if (_repeatType == Controller.RT_WRAP) {
alpha = (_elapsed - (int)_elapsed);
} else { // _repeatType == Controller.RT_CYCLE
int ipart = (int)_elapsed;
float fpart = (_elapsed - ipart);
alpha = (ipart % 2 == 0) ? fpart : (1f - fpart);
}
_target.getLocalTranslation().interpolate(_from, _to, alpha);
}
@Override
public Controller putClone (
Controller store, Model.CloneCreator properties)
{
Translator tstore;
if (store == null) {
tstore = new Translator();
} else {
tstore = (Translator)store;
}
super.putClone(tstore, properties);
tstore._from = _from;
tstore._to = _to;
tstore._duration = _duration;
tstore._repeatType = _repeatType;
return tstore;
}
@Override
public void read (JMEImporter im)
throws IOException
{
super.read(im);
InputCapsule capsule = im.getCapsule(this);
_from = (Vector3f)capsule.readSavable("from", null);
_to = (Vector3f)capsule.readSavable("to", null);
_duration = capsule.readFloat("duration", 1f);
_repeatType = capsule.readInt("repeatType", Controller.RT_WRAP);
}
@Override
public void write (JMEExporter ex)
throws IOException
{
super.write(ex);
OutputCapsule capsule = ex.getCapsule(this);
capsule.write(_from, "from", null);
capsule.write(_to, "to", null);
capsule.write(_duration, "duration", 1f);
capsule.write(_repeatType, "repeatType", Controller.RT_WRAP);
}
/** The beginning and end of the path. */
protected Vector3f _from, _to;
/** The duration of the path. */
protected float _duration;
/** What to do after reaching the destination. */
protected int _repeatType;
/** The accumulated amount of time elapsed. */
protected transient float _elapsed;
private static final long serialVersionUID = 1;
}
